Serve. White tea ought to be served as it is, unadulterated. You might select to pour milk or sugar in the white tea, but the already subtle flavor of the tea will be drowned out. If you really like tea remember to pop round the corner to our new Concept Retailer, 111 Rose St, to shop for all your tea related goodies.The tea that the typical tea drinker is not as familiar with is a decoction. A decoction is completed with a tea that is created up of nuts, bark, or roots. It is not as effortless to get taste or advantage out of these tougher components. For that cause a medicinal decoction is usually covered with cold water in a covered pot and brought to a simmer on the stove. Right after at least ten-15 minutes the decoction is strained and is prepared to drink.Producing tea sandwiches for a crowd, or even just a handful of people, can be fiddly perform.
